The Dash Rapid Egg Cooker is a BPA-free, electric kitchen appliance designed to cook up to 7 eggs simultaneously with precision. Featuring a built-in thermal sensor, it effortlessly prepares hard-boiled, soft-boiled, poached, scrambled eggs, and omelets. Its compact, space-saving design includes dishwasher-safe parts for quick cleanup, making it the ultimate time-saving tool for busy professionals seeking a nutritious start to their day.

Great little product! Hard-boiled eggs are no longer a challenge!
Bought this about two years ago because the egg-timer I had that actually sits in the boiling water with the eggs wasn't working as consistently as I had hoped. I saw this Dash Rapid egg Cooker and decided to give it a try. Love it! Mostly the eggs are cooked to satisfactory doneness, although occasionally a smidge under (but not grossly) or a tad over, but definitely cooked and edible. I found that using the 4+ level on the measuring cup for 6 eggs and filling it to just above that mark is enough water to cook the eggs to the required doneness. I've used the omelet feature a couple of times and it's okay, but mainly I use the DASH Rapid Egg Cooker for making hard-boiled eggs. My husband loves hard-boiled eggs so this was a great way to make sure he had his weekly quota. I would recommend this product! I've read other reviews where the purchaser said there's no way to store the trays and other paraphernalia, which is not exactly true. The trays (there are three; one for boiled eggs, one for scrambled, and a split tray for maybe omelets) fit conveniently inside the unit, with the stem and measuring/poking cup nestled in the split tray. I've not had any issues with them not fitting. And there is just one way to use the stem (I rarely use it, though) and it fits just one way, too. Doesn't take a rocket scientist to figure out (and I am not a rocket scientist!). If I can figure it out, anyone else can, too. :-D Also, the poker under the measuring cup does well enough, although I will say it requires a bit of steady pressure to poke a hole in the top of the egg. This is necessary to allow the air inside to escape; otherwise your egg will explode! A trick I did to enhance peeling is to (very) gently rap the top of the egg with the back of a spoon to release the membrane inside. When you hear a snap, you've succeeded. It sounds like the egg cracked but it's only the membrane inside that's making the noise. After boiling, the egg shell should peel easily off. The DASH Rapid Egg Cooker does smell a bit at the end of cooking, but it helps if – after every use - you gently clean the heating surface (after it cools) with a wet paper towel, drying it thoroughly before putting it away. However, it will still develop a color, so its one flaw is that it does not clean up easily. Also, the tray with the six 'seats' for the eggs also gets somewhat dirty over time, so a good rinse is all you need to do after each use. The DASH Rapid Egg Cooker does not have an auto-shutoff feature, but it will let you know when it's done by playing a sweet little tune. It is loud and for good reason; you want to be able to hear it. You do not want this unit to continue cooking, so I appreciate the tone level a lot. That said, the company could probably improve this product by installing a shut-off. The only downside is if you rely on that rather than the end of cycle tune, your eggs might be more done than you want. For those of you who are sensitive to loud sounds, I would give consideration to other ways of boiling eggs. The drop-in silicone egg timer (the one that boils with the eggs) is a good solution, as long as you keep an eye on the color changes. I just had a tough time doing that so that's why I chose DASH Rapid Egg Cooker for boiling my eggs. Overall, I really like my Dash Rapid egg Cooker. It has simplified a task that for years had plagued me with overdone or underdone boiled eggs. Now I can with confidence supply my husband with his favorite breakfast treat! Four stars for satisfaction, one minus star for the unit not having a shut-off feature.
